feat(image): add rounded-square and squircle crop tool (#602)

Adds a Rounded Crop image tool for logo, favicon, and app-icon work. It masks the framed square to a rounded rectangle (with a corner-radius control) or an iOS-style squircle, reusing circle-crop's zoom/offset framing, border ring, background fill, and output-size options. Includes translations across all 21 locales.

Closes #601

const PREVIEW_D = 200; // crop box side in the inline preview, px
type Shape = "rounded-square" | "squircle";
// CSS clip-path polygon tracing the same superellipse the backend renders,
// so the squircle preview matches the output. Kept module-level: it never
// changes, so there's nothing to recompute per render.
const SQUIRCLE_CLIP = (() => {
const n = 4;
const exp = 2 / n;
const pts: string[] = [];
for (let i = 0; i < 64; i++) {
const t = (i / 64) * 2 * Math.PI;
const c = Math.cos(t);
const s = Math.sin(t);
const x = 50 + 50 * Math.sign(c) * Math.abs(c) ** exp;
const y = 50 + 50 * Math.sign(s) * Math.abs(s) ** exp;
pts.push(`${x.toFixed(2)}% ${y.toFixed(2)}%`);
}
return `polygon(${pts.join(",")})`;
})();
